Including Youth in Our Workplace with Janelle Hinds

Episode Overview

Janelle Hinds is an award-winning entrepreneur, public speaker, facilitator and Diversity Equity and Inclusion and strategic consultant.  Before her maternity leave, Janelle was the Senior Manager of Strategic Partnerships at Opportunity for All Youth, where the focus is creating better youth futures by helping youth who face barriers find meaningful jobs that build skills and experience. Janelle is the founder of Helping Hands, a non-profit that aims to help young people build their skills and careers through volunteer, entrepreneurship, and early career development. 

As a public speaker and consultant, Janelle is an advocate for social innovation and Diversity Equity and Inclusion in various industries. Janelle sits on the Board of Directors for Futurpreneur as well as the McMaster Alumni Association Board. Recently Janelle was chosen as the only Canadian on Forbes Top 30 Under 30 list for her achievements in the Education sector. 

“The amount of hurdles entrepreneurs go through, we could qualify to win some olympic medals.”

In this week’s episode of the #StartupPodcast, sponsored by Mastercard and Scotiabank, we talk to Janelle Hinds about her journey building Helping Hands and why supporting youth to build their skills and careers matters.
